CQWP with Nintex task form, redirects to &RootFolder which doesn't exist


Badge +5

I have a Content Query Web Part which I'm showing all pending approval tasks for approvers. The CQWP sits on a separate subsite to the tasks.

 

When the approver finishes their task, they are redirected, but it errors.

 

(I have removed main part of URL and left server relative URLs)

Here is the URL on the task form:

&wtg=/workflows/WorkflowTasks/Nintex%20Task%20Outcomes%201ce7e562-d212-4a9a-a53c-26b095ceea14&mode=1&callertype=Task&List=9a69b155-3f20-4edb-ac55-ddaea17951dd&ID=53&RootFolder=/workflows/WorkflowTasks&Source=/mytoolbox/Pages/leave.aspx&Web=8d89b807-8b2d-4760-a252-1017407b5a33

 

Here is the URL on redirect:

/mytoolbox/Pages/leave.aspx?RootFolder=%2fworkflows%2fWorkflowTasks

 

Here is the error:

No item exists at /mytoolbox/Pages/leave.aspx?RootFolder=/workflows/WorkflowTasks.  It may have been deleted or renamed by another user.

 

I'm guessing the issue is the &RootFolder as it doesn't exist on the source site and there's no way to overwrite the root folder parameter?

 

Has anyone else come across this or have any suggestions?

Workaround is to update the button control setting on the form and set the "Redirect URL" property.
